Mastering the Art of Website Development: From Design to Deployment
Embarking on the journey of website development can feel overwhelming, but with a structured approach and dedication, you can develop your vision into a compelling online presence. The process comprises several key stages, from conceptualization and design to coding and deployment.
- To begin, define your website's purpose and target audience. What objectives do you hope to achieve? Who are you trying to connect with? Answering these questions will guide your design choices and content strategy.
- Then, dive into the design phase. Create wireframes and mockups to illustrate the structure and layout of your website. Think about user experience, ensuring intuitive navigation and a visually appealing appearance.
- In the coding phase, bring your design to life using programming languages such as HTML, CSS, and JavaScript. Enhance your code for speed, accessibility, and search engine visibility.
- Last but not least, deploy your website to a web server. Choose a hosting service that meets your needs in terms of storage, bandwidth, and security.
Continuously analyze your website's performance using analytics tools. Implement necessary updates and improvements to ensure your site remains engaging over time.
